Live and Google Up, Yahoo Down in November

Hitwise, announced today that Google accounted for 71.97 percent of all U.S. searches in the four weeks ending Nov. 29, 2008. Yahoo! Search, MSN Search and Ask.com each received 17.70 percent, 5.45 percent and 3.35 percent, respectively. The remaining 43 search engines in the Hitwise Search Engine Analysis Tool accounted for 1.53 percent of U.S. searches.

Percentage of U.S.searches among leading search engine providers

Domain

November 2007

October 2008

November 2008

www.google.com

63.15%

71.70%

71.97%

search.yahoo.com

21.62%

17.74%

17.70%

search.msn.com

9.80%*

5.40%*

5.45%*

www.ask.com

3.72%

3.53%

3.35%

Note: Data is based on four-week rolling periods (ending Nov. 29, 2008; Nov. 1, 2008; and Nov. 24, 2007) from the Hitwise sample of 10 million U.S. Internet users.

Source: Hitwise, an Experian company
